About Me  
Tyler Langdale knew from his first yoga class that he would open his own studio one day. But it wasn't until he and Sacramento lobbyist Josh Pane, a devoted friend and yoga client, spent a month studying yoga, traditional healing and Buddhism in India and China that he seriously considered it. The 27-year-old yoga teacher and the former city councilman were walking on a beach in Goa on India's west coast. The Arabian Sea shimmered as the idea crystallized in Pane's mind. "I turned to Tyler and I said, 'Tyler — you've got to open up a yoga studio,' " Pane said. Now the two are partnering to open the central city's newest yoga studio, Yoga Shala Sacramento, in the recently renovated YWCA of Contra Costa/Sacramento. They held their grand opening Tuesday evening at the historic building, 1122 17th St. Langdale led about 100 people through a series of yoga poses or asanas intended to stretch, strengthen, relax and rebalance. The trip last fall was the culmination of two years of private yoga study. Their studio is named after the yoga center in India where they deepened their practices, Mysore Mandala Yogashala.
